phpMyAdmin
 sql >> Database >  >> Database Tools >> phpMyAdmin

Ricerca in un database con PhpMyAdmin

L'uso di PhpMyAdmin per cercare record e informazioni nel database può aiutarti a ottenere rapidamente le informazioni di cui hai bisogno senza dover eseguire query di ricerca avanzate. Questo tutorial presuppone che tu abbia già effettuato l'accesso a PhpMyAdmin e mostra come cercare per parola chiave e per una serie di record.

Innanzitutto, dalla schermata principale di PhpMyAdmin, possiamo fare clic sul nome del database dal menu di navigazione a sinistra. In questo esempio, abbiamo selezionato il database lwtest_wpdb che è un database WordPress di prova preso da un sito live.

Abbiamo quindi fatto clic su Cerca scheda nella parte superiore della pagina PhpMyAdmin

Come possiamo vedere dall'immagine qui sotto, questa è una ricerca per parola chiave generale. Metteremo "test ” nella casella di ricerca per mostrare le funzionalità di base, ma le altre opzioni in “Trova ” può anche mostrare record con più termini di ricerca. Questo cercherà la stringa esatta che è stata inserita, oppure possiamo anche usare espressioni regolari per cercare. Usando la casella della tabella vista sotto, possiamo selezionare le tabelle in cui vogliamo eseguire la ricerca, o semplicemente fare clic su "Seleziona tutto" per cercare tutte le tabelle nel database. Quindi possiamo fare clic sul pulsante Vai in basso a destra nella pagina per avviare la ricerca.

La pagina dei risultati ci mostra il numero di corrispondenze presenti in ciascuna tabella che abbiamo cercato. Per le tabelle che hanno avuto la ricerca, termine possiamo cliccare su Sfoglia per visualizzare i risultati. Faremo clic su Sfoglia per la tabella wp_options e vedere le 4 corrispondenze restituite dalla nostra ricerca.

La pagina seguente mostra la query effettiva utilizzata da PhpMyAdmin per ottenere i risultati. Se volessimo eseguire la query manualmente o modificare ulteriormente la ricerca, possiamo copiare la query da lì. Dopodiché, mostra la tabella con ogni record che conteneva "test". Una cosa importante da notare, la query corrispondeva a "test " quando è stato trovato sia in maiuscolo, sia in minuscolo e la parola "Test ”. La nostra query ha persino elencato i due risultati trovati nell'indirizzo email e ha comunque contato solo quel risultato come un record.

Successivamente, possiamo cercare un intervallo di dati utilizzando la Cerca della tabella scheda. Quindi clicchiamo sul nome della tabella che vogliamo cercare dai database nella navigazione a sinistra, in questo caso cercheremo la tabella wp_comments. Abbiamo quindi fatto clic sulla scheda Cerca nella parte superiore di questa pagina.

La Ricerca La scheda è diversa dalla ricerca a livello di database in quanto mostra le colonne della tabella, il tipo di dati che memorizzano e offre la possibilità di eseguire ricerche utilizzando operatori diversi.

Queste opzioni possono aiutarci a individuare una serie di dati. Se esaminiamo le opzioni di ricerca per il campo comment_ID, possiamo selezionare < (meno di ) e inserire un valore di 400. Quindi faremo clic sull'Vai pulsante in basso a destra per iniziare la nostra ricerca.

La nostra pagina dei risultati indica che 267 record sono stati abbinati durante la ricerca di un comment_ID inferiore a 400. Ora possiamo rivedere quei record, modificare, copiare o eliminare i record che desideriamo, oppure modificare di nuovo la ricerca e continuare a cercare!

Conclusione

Dall'interfaccia PhpMyAdmin possiamo cercare rapidamente nei database dati e intervalli specifici facilmente tramite una finestra del browser. Questo è molto più semplice rispetto all'esecuzione manuale delle query tramite la riga di comando.

Inoltre, i risultati di ricerca forniti consentono anche una facile modifica, copia e rimozione. PhpMyAdmin visualizza anche le query che utilizza per eseguire le azioni di ricerca. Questo può essere utilizzato anche come strumento di apprendimento o riferimento per scrivere o creare una nuova query che può essere utilizzata in un secondo momento.

Navigazione serie<>